Anutin Signs Order Removing Siripong as Government Spokesperson Following Resignation, Set to Become Sisaket MP for District 1

The Royal Gazette announced a Prime Minister's Office order removing Siripong Angkasungkornkiat from the government spokesperson position after his resignation on 5 February 2026. He is preparing to become the Member of Parliament for Sisaket District 1 following his election victory in 2026.


On 17 February 2026, the website The Royal Gazette publishedPrime Minister's Office Order No. 38/2569 regarding the removal of a political official from office.Signed by Prime Minister Anutin Charnvirakul on 11 February 2026, the order stated the following:

Pursuant to Prime Minister's Office Order No. 310/2568 dated 30 September 2025 appointing Mr. Siripong Angkasungkornkiat as a political official holding the position of government spokesperson at the Prime Minister's Office effective from 30 September 2025,

Since Mr. Siripong Angkasungkornkiat submitted his resignation effective 5 February 2026, under Section 10 (2) of the Political Officials Act B.E. 2535 (1992), he is hereby removed from the position of government spokesperson at the Prime Minister's Office due to resignation, effective from 5 February 2026.

Additional reports indicate that Mr. Siripong ran as a candidate for Member of Parliament representing Sisaket District 1 for the Bhumjaithai Party, receiving the highest number of votes in the election held on 8 February 2026. The official confirmation by the Election Commission is pending. His resignation is expected to comply with legal provisions prohibiting MPs from simultaneously holding political official positions.
